Just to make a complaint, the basic weapon damage of COC and DND is basically the same: knife d4, stick d6~d8, and revolver 2d6. If you deduce it this way and throw the value of modern weapons in COC into DND, then the output efficiency of the evocation spell is really not as good as that of modern weapons (the focus is the output efficiency of the evocation spell) Classic 3-ring fireball, d6 per casting level, up to 10d6. The rookie mage's is close to the grenade 4d10, and is slightly stronger than the mortar 6d10 at the maximum 10d6 8 ring sun burst, 6d6 plus blindness, undead/mud/tan type special attack d6 per casting level, up to 25d6 (25~150) 9 ring meteor burst, 4 balls, 2 each d6 blunt weapon plus 6d6 flame, a total of 32d6 (32~192) M72 anti-tank gun (bazooka, rpg) 8d10 (8~80), 75mm field gun/120mm tank gun 10d10 (10~100), 127 naval gun 15d10 (15~150) Lecture The output of the evocation spell is really not as good as using other spells to control the field. You are exhausted and fighting 10 meteor bursts in 10 rounds per minute (however, how much intelligence does it take and how luxurious the equipment is for a legendary mage to have so many spell slots), 320 to 1920 points of damage, and the Italian 127 naval gun next door fires at 40 rounds per minute, which is 600 to 6000 per minute. . . . You said that if there is no water in the surrounding area and the destroyers can't get in, they can also use land artillery. The entire artillery battalion of 152 or 150 may have more powerful firepower.
